MPD to students: Keep your dogs on leash

Students reminded to keep dogs on leash on campus and in city limits

After an ever-increasing rate in reported dog bites, Moscow Police Department wants to remind students to keep their dogs on-leash.

Alan Johnson, code enforcement officer with the Moscow Police Department, said he has reminded several students in the early weeks of fall dogs are not only required to be on-leash on University of Idaho campus, but within Moscow city limits.

Johnson said in 2019 there have already been 18 reported dog bites, compared to 18 total in both 2017 and 2018.

Johnson said his typical approach when he sees someone with a dog off-leash on campus is to simply approach them and have a conversation, pointing them in the direction of the two dog parks in town. After several conversations with the same person about off-leash pets, Johnson said that is when he will issue a citation — something he said he has not yet had to do. Dogs off-leash within city limits is a violation of city ordinance, therefore a misdemeanor violation.

Johnson recommended those wanting to let their pups run free go to one of the two local dog parks: Mountain View Dog Park, located at 2052 W Mountain View Road or Moscow Dog Park at 2019 White Avenue.
